Output 892c370fe5d8ebe6489b46eb18aa108a604e22baf343feab77a41266b1065449:1

value
518323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fcdd0e035568a7c747e1d8d4a2ad4c03908fe2 OP_EQUAL
address
3CdTFdo8wQh2T6DsJE5B2XkVVCEM92XBwU
transaction
892c370fe5d8ebe6489b46eb18aa108a604e22baf343feab77a41266b1065449
spent
true